AIR is seeking a User Experience/User Interface (UX/UI) and Visualization Designer. The UX/UI Visualization Designer is responsible for developing, delivering, and maintaining application and visualization design assets used to support data application products. The UX/UI Designer will focus on creating new features and visualizations as well as maintaining application design assets.

The main objective will be to design and refine new application and visualization features for implementation by the development team to build greater use of the Famine Early Warning Systems Network's (FEWS NET)Hub's data and data systems. The UX/UI Designer will manage central support with the development team in order to ensure consistent branding and adequate design strategies are being implemented across FEWS NET related applications. The UX/UI Designer achieves this through expertise in design practices, technical understanding, and clear and concise wireframing methodology.

About AIR:

Established in 1946, with headquarters in Arlington, Virginia, AIR is a nonpartisan, not-for-profit institution that conducts behavioral and social science research and delivers technical assistance to solve some of the most urgent challenges in the U.S. and around the world. We advance evidence in the areas of education, health, the workforce, human services, and international development to create a better, more equitable world.

Responsibilities:

The UX/UI Designer is responsible for synthesizing feature requirements and guidance for data and web platforms into successful design implementation to share the value of FEWS NET's content and engage audiences. In addition, the UX/UI Designer is responsible for supporting the design of internal Hub applications and visualization features. Specific responsibilities include:



  • Develop, deliver and maintain design guidance, as well as new application and visualization features.
  • Translate complex technical feature requirements into accessible applications and visualizations.
  • Support application and visualization design through checks for compliance with style and brand guidance.
  • Coordinate with the software engineers to develop usable wire-frames that can be easily implemented into applications and visualizations.
  • Consult with stakeholders to assist in implementing new updates to applications and visualizations.
